Page-specific field notes
Agadir for Couples is easiest to plan when broad recommendations are converted into decisions for the actual date and group. In particular, the Kasbah viewpoint works best when haze is low and the city lights begin to appear. Travelers should also remember that a quiet meal in Talborjt offers a different atmosphere from the marina. These details affect timing and comfort more than an ambitious checklist.
Before setting out, verify the detail most likely to change: weather, opening pattern, pickup boundary, road access or current ground conditions. For this subject, private departures give couples more control over photo stops. It is equally useful to know that Paradise Valley is more relaxed when visited before the busiest part of the day. A recent local confirmation is more reliable than an undated social post, especially where nature or transport shapes the experience.
Allow enough margin for an unhurried stop and a realistic return. The practical lesson is that one planned experience leaves room for an unhurried beach walk. Keep water, sun protection, secure footwear and the accommodation address available whenever they suit the route. If an operator is involved, ask for the duration, inclusions and meeting arrangement in writing.
